  * Travel report from FOSDEM
   * Karen met with the Debian packages for GNOME and asked the
current state of Debian
   * The Debian packagers feel demotivated by the current situation
   * They agreed to blog more on the issue
   * The Debian packagers asked for a technical position from the
GNOME project for the use of systemd
   * Maybe have a joint statement with KDE as they moved to systemd as well
    * Involve other environments like XFCE
   * '''ACTION''': Karen and Emmanuele to draft a common/cross-desktop
position on systemd

== Discussed on the mailing list ==
 * GCompris switch to QML for iOS and Android support
  * The maintainer graciously informed the board beforehand
  * Effects on GSoC
  * GTK does not support Android and iOS, and there's no current
effort for that; Bruno's effort alone would not be sufficient
  * Qt/QML has commercial interest to support those platforms
